Gulmarg Gondola Ride overview

Combining adventure and stunning natural beauty, the Gulmarg Gondola, Asia's tallest and longest cable car, provides a guided ride to 4,200-meter Apharwat Mountain. The French company Pomagalski and the government of Jammu and Kashmir collaborated to create this two-stage ropeway, which offers a smooth ride through breathtaking scenery. A knowledgeable guide who is bilingual in Hindi and English will accompany you on the trip and offer insights into the natural beauty of the region. Starting at Gulmarg Resort at 2,600 meters, the journey first ascends to Kongdori Station in a picturesque bowl-shaped valley.

Phase I runs from Gulmarg to Kongdori with a horizontal length of 2,091 meters, carrying up to 1,500 passengers per hour in 72 cabins. The ride travels 2,539.99 meters from Kongdori to Apharwat in Phase II, carrying 600 passengers per hour in 34 cabins. Visitors can pause at Kongdori for admirable views of the meadow. They then continue on to Apharwat, where they can marvel at the breathtaking views of mountains covered in snow. As an alternative, tourists may choose to combine the two stages into a single, once-in-a-lifetime experience. Best Time to Visit the Gulmarg Gondola

The Gondola Ride, Gulmarg offers a beautiful and spectacular experience all year round, with each season offering a unique landscape.

If you are a snow lover and winter sports enthusiast, consider planning your visit between December and February. During these months, Gulmarg turns into a magical snowy landscape that is perfect for skiing. On the other hand, if you wish to enjoy views of the lush greenery and clear mountains, go for a trip to Gulmarg in the months between May and September. The spring season brings blooming flowers and comfortable temperatures, making it another great time to take the ride. 

Note: It is best to take the ride in the early morning for optimal visibility, fewer crowds, and a longer time to spend on the Apharwat peak.

How to Reach the Gulmarg Gondola

By Taxi: Visitors can take private taxis and cabs from the Gulmarg city centre, which will take them directly to the Gulmarg gondola ride booking point, which is only a few kilometres away. The ride takes approximately 15-20 minutes, offering scenic views of the Himalayas. 

Hike: If you are an adventure seeker, you can take a hike from the Gulmarg main market to the Gulmarg Gondola station. The entire uphill trail is only 1.5 km and will provide you with an immersive experience amidst nature. 

Horse Ride: Horses are available to rent near the Gulmarg bus stand and visitors can enjoy this unique way to reach the gondola station while enjoying views of the surrounding meadows on horseback. 

Gulmarg Gondola Ride: Phases and Levels

Phase I: The first phase of the Gondola ride, Gulmarg runs from Gulmarg base station to Kungdoor and takes visitors from 2650m to 3050m above sea level. It’s a 10-minute ride that offers breathtaking views of the Kashmir valley and even gives access to the best spots for winter activities like skiing and snowboarding. 

Phase II: In the second phase of the ride, the Gulmarg gondola ascends to Apharwat Peak at 4200m from Kungdoor. This level is known for its deep snow, off-site skiing and stunning panoramic views of the Himalayan peaks like the Pir Panjal range. The ride to the top takes about 12-15 minutes and provides visitors with a breathtaking experience above the clouds.

History of Gulmarg Gondola Ride

The Gulmarg gondola ride was launched as a joint initiative between the Jammu and Kashmir government and the French company ‘Pomagalski’ in the year 1998. The aim of this project was to boost tourism in the beautiful hill city of Gulmarg, which is also one of India’s most famous ski destinations. 

In the beginning, the project only included operations for Phase 1, but Phase 2 was later added and opened in 2005, making it one of the highest cable car rides in the world. The Gulmarg cable car ride has since then become a major attraction, drawing travelers from around the world.

Gulmarg Gondola Ride faqs

Is the Gulmarg Gondola cable car ride safe?

Yes, the Gulmarg cable car ride is absolutely safe and undergoes regular maintenance. Professional operators present on the ground ensure the smooth functioning of this unique activity. Additionally, the gondola cars are fully enclosed, offering protection from the harsh weather and winds at such heights.

What is the distance between Gulmarg and the Gondola boarding point?

The Gulmarg Gondola ride boarding point is about 1.5 km from the town's main market. Visitors can choose from a local private taxi, a pony ride or even choose to hike to the boarding point if looking for a more adventurous experience. 

What are some things to do in Phase I and Phase II of the Gulmarg Gondola?

Visitors will find plenty of things to do in both phases of the Gondola ride, Gulmarg. In phase 1, you can enjoy skiing, snowboarding and sled rides at Kungdoor. In phase 2, you will ascend to Apharwat Peak, where you can enjoy breathtaking views of the Nanga Parbat and Harmukh Mountain, get more hiking opportunities, and advanced skiing routes.
